Health advancements

Health advancements play a crucial role in improving medical treatments and patient outcomes. Scientific research has led to significant breakthroughs in the healthcare sector, revolutionizing the way diseases are diagnosed and treated. By investing in research, we unlock the potential to discover new therapies, enhance diagnostic tools, and ultimately save countless lives. The continuous progress in medical science enables doctors to provide more personalized and effective care to patients, leading to better health outcomes and improved quality of life.

One of the key benefits of health advancements is the development of cutting-edge technologies that aid in early detection and treatment of diseases. Innovations such as genetic testing, advanced imaging techniques, and precision medicine have transformed the way healthcare professionals approach patient care. These tools allow for more accurate diagnoses, tailored treatment plans, and improved monitoring of disease progression. As a result, patients receive timely interventions that can significantly impact their prognosis and overall well-being.

Moreover, research-driven health advancements have paved the way for breakthrough therapies that target specific diseases at the molecular level. New treatments, such as immunotherapy and gene editing, have shown promising results in treating previously untreatable conditions. These innovative approaches not only offer hope to patients with advanced illnesses but also open up new possibilities for future treatment modalities. The ability to harness the power of scientific research to develop targeted therapies represents a significant milestone in the fight against complex diseases.

In addition to treatment innovations, health advancements have also fostered improvements in preventive medicine and public health strategies. Research findings have led to the development of vaccines, preventive screenings, and health education programs that help individuals maintain optimal health and reduce the risk of developing chronic conditions. By promoting proactive health measures and early intervention, scientific research plays a vital role in preventing diseases and promoting overall well-being.
